Transaction 26dca04dcc55bd8506a93c5fd9cba970fe6a071ecf33f30ec8d5be0ce3014cb4
1 Input
1 Output
-
26dca04dcc55bd8506a93c5fd9cba970fe6a071ecf33f30ec8d5be0ce3014cb4:0
- value
- 607796
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d843044efbae47ae0f0bfd75dc3d97a5fb2c9e78 OP_EQUAL
- address
- 3MQWAPacQC15As5YZAyubRgB8LM1H5r9QH